These six pictures were snapped by Mr. Ed Anderson during the 1930's at Emory and the limestone quarry high above the Merced River. Mr. Anderson at that time was a teenager and worked for his uncle Quarry Supervisor Mr. Bill Jastram. All photos are the courtesy of Mr. Ed Anderson and thanks to Judy Jastram, the granddaughter of Bill Jastram for putting us in contact with Ed Anderson.
